THE POSITION
The Red Hat Linux Senior Engineer provides senior-level engineering and administration support for Red Hat/Linux-based systems. The position supports monitoring, management, and integration of enterprise system management tools used to assess the operational status and performance of Control (C2) systems.
This role designs, configures, maintains, and enhances Linux-based monitoring applications and supporting infrastructure used by the contract enterprise monitoring architecture. The engineer develops and integrates custom software interfaces, maintains system monitoring tools, and ensures operational availability of mission-critical applications supporting global C2 environments.
The position operates within a classified enterprise environment supporting operations at the Pentagon and COOP site. The engineer collaborates with system administrators, database administrators, network engineers, and application teams to support the monitoring and reporting capabilities required for the mission. Responsibilities include maintaining system monitoring applications, integrating commercial and government-off-the-shelf tools, and ensuring the availability and security of Linux-based monitoring systems supporting operational command and control capabilities.
RESPONSIBILITIES:
- Design, develop, integrate, and maintain Linux-based monitoring applications supporting the GCCS-J Management Center monitoring infrastructure.
- Develop, install, operate, and maintain system monitoring applications and web-based dashboards used to monitor enterprise C2 systems.
- Maintain Red Hat/Linux-based monitoring platforms and associated application services used to support system monitoring tools.
- Integrate COTS and GOTS monitoring tools to support enterprise systems management and operational monitoring requirements.
- Design, configure, and maintain monitoring tool integrations including Network Node Manager, Net Health, CA Systems Edge, EMPIRE, EMPSEC, and related enterprise monitoring platforms.
- Develop customized software programs, scripts, and interfaces to support enterprise monitoring functions and automation of system management tasks.
- Design, install, configure, and optimize system servers and application components supporting monitoring tools to ensure high availability and operational performance.
- Troubleshoot complex hardware, network, and software issues impacting monitoring systems and coordinate resolution with internal teams and vendors as required.
- Implement software patches, hot fixes, and system upgrades in accordance with security and configuration management procedures.
- Maintain system documentation, configuration documentation, and technical implementation procedures supporting monitoring tools and applications.
- Perform daily system and application auditing activities to ensure operational compliance and system availability.
- Provide technical training and knowledge transfer to government personnel and system administrators supporting monitoring tools and applications.

PREFERRED:
1. Linux System Administration and Engineering
- Experience performing Linux installation including hardware identification and configuration.
- Experience performing Linux operating system upgrades and patching.
- Experience installing, upgrading, and maintaining enterprise applications on Linux including Apache Tomcat and Java-based applications.
- Familiarity with Linux system administration troubleshooting techniques including system logs and performance analysis.
- Experience creating and forwarding logs and performing log analytics to troubleshoot system and application issues.
- Familiarity with scripting languages, specifically Bash, to automate administrative and operational tasks.
2. Security and Compliance
- Experience applying server certificates, including knowledge of certificate authorities and certificate acquisition processes.
- Experience downloading, reviewing, and applying DISA Security Technical Implementation Guides (STIGs) to Linux systems.
3. Virtualization and Infrastructure
- Experience installing and configuring VMware environments, including hardware configuration, BIOS settings, and firmware upgrades.
- Experience performing Linux and VMware operating system upgrades when updates become available.
- Familiarity with VMware virtual infrastructure administration supporting enterprise systems.
4. Storage and Enterprise Platform Support
- Experience with NetApp storage administration, including creating and mapping volumes to systems.
- Experience supporting enterprise storage architectures integrated with Linux environments.
5. Enterprise Linux Management Tools
- Experience creating repository data (repodata) and managing Linux package repositories.
- Experience installing, configuring, and maintaining Red Hat Satellite Server for enterprise patching and system management.
